问题        Though agreeing with Descartes that consciousness and extension are
       qualitatively distinct, Spinoza’s dual-aspect theory denied that consciousness
       and extension are inherent characteristics of two finite substances, treating
Line     them instead as attributes of the infinite substance of a transcendent
(5)      intelligence. While mental occurrences can dictate only other mental
       occurrences and physical motions can determine only other physical motions,
       mind and body exist in pre-established coordination, since the same self-
       consistent intelligence establishes affinities and connections within both classes.
       Another alternative, psychophysical parallelism, retains both the dualism of
(10)     mind and body and the notion of a regular correlation between mental and
       physical events, but avoids any assumption of causal mind-body connection,
       direct or indirect. Psychophysical parallelism eschews interactionism, stating
       that mental and physical could not possibly affect one another, and also rejects
       occasionalism and dual-aspect theory on the grounds that no third entity,
(15)     including a transcendent intelligence,  could be responsible for such vastly
       different effects. Parallelists accept only pure correlations, not causation,
       between mental and physical events.
